What a wonderful IC site! I love all the fabulous little drawings! I was inspired by This but the suitcases by themselves weren't so interesting on my card, so I put them in front of the window.
I stamped & colored the train image then put a window on top w/ the fussy cut suitcases in front. I wanted it to look like someone waiting in the station for the train to come in. After die cutting the window, I used an embossing folder on the lower 2/3 of it to resemble bead board paneling.
